Android App Review: QIK

“Live from your cell phone, it’s Saturday night!” or any other showtime. QIK (pronounced “quick”), for Android phones, lets you stream live video directly from your cell phone to the Internet and then automatically shares it on social networks and blogs. Does this really work?

sashaThe application downloaded and installed without a hitch on my HTC Hero. I registered for the service through my cell phone, but then went to a PC to do the configuration. (I’ve yet to connect with the joy of typing on a cell phone keyboard.)

The first field test involved annoying my daughter’s cat. Wisely, the moment the cat saw me pointing something at her, she attempted to retreat to a more defensive position. My first video ambush worked and can be found here .
